It's still pretty neat that SEGA still remembers the Space Channel 5 franchise.

Then again, we did have two stages in Rhythm Thief and the Emperor's Treasure (released in 2012, I believe) that were homages to the Space Channel 5 games in every way possible, from the gameplay to the music to the weird jerky animation.
